Clean Water May Still Pose Health Risk for Swimmers
Swimmers who dip into the pollution-free waters of sub-tropical
beaches, such as those in southern Florida, face an elevated risk
for developing gastrointestinal and/or respiratory illnesses, a new
study indicates. The study, which involved tracking 1,300 South
Florida beach-going residents, was released online in advance of
publication in an upcoming print issue of the International Journal
of Epidemiology.
